Steam Deck на Valve направи революция в игрите на Linux, но все още има няколко добри причини, поради които засега трябва да се придържате към компютри с Windows.

Linux най-накрая се справи с това, което преди беше невъзможна задача: наваксване с игрите на Windows. Или поне изглежда така, до голяма степен благодарение на работещата с Linux конзола Steam Deck на Valve. Но дали е вярно? Можете ли най-накрая да изоставите Windows и да преминете към Linux като геймър?

Е, не толкова бързо. Все още има някои уговорки, така че нека проучим защо отговорът не е толкова ясен.

Игровата революция на Valve в Linux

Всичко започна, когато Valve се почувства застрашен от Microsoft Store. Тогава се появи идеята за създаване на алтернативна платформа. Би било толкова лесно за използване, колкото игрална конзола, но базирано на широко разпространен компютърен хардуер и работещо с „отворена“ операционна система, която не се контролира от Microsoft.

Решението на Valve, наречено "Steam Machines", няма да разчита на персонализиран хардуер, за разлика от конзолите преди най-новите PlayStation и Xboxes. Всеки продавач трета страна може да създаде своя собствена „Steam Machine“, както намери за добре. Единствената обща точка между всички Steam машини би била персонализираната операционна система на Valve, базирана на Linux, SteamOS.

instagram viewer

Проектът се провали поради различни причини, които няма да засягаме в тази статия. За щастие Valve не се отказа.

Steam Deck е кулминацията на усилията на Valve за създаване на собствена хардуерна и софтуерна "платформа" за игри.

Хаптичните тъчпадове на Steam Deck носят ДНК от Steam Controller на Valve. Неговата операционна система е по-нова версия на SteamOS. Вижте нашата статия за всичко, което трябва да знаете за Steam Deck на Valve за да научите повече за това.

Как Valve пренесе игрите в Linux

Valve разбра, че разполага с несравнима колекция от хиляди заглавия, правейки другите платформи бледи в сравнение с тях. Но въпреки че имаше „библиотеката“, нямаше най-важното нещо: самата „платформа“.

Ето защо започна да подкрепя проектите WINE и Proton, като плаща на програмисти да работят по тях, за да ускорят развитието им. Разберете как те постигат своята магия в нашата статия за какво е Steam Proton и как работи с Windows Games на Steam Deck.

Благодарение на тези два проекта, Steam Deck, работещ с модифицирана версия на Arch Linux, вече е съвместим със значителна част от библиотеката на Steam Store, вместо с друга неуспешна „Steam Machine“.

За щастие, това върви и в двете посоки и поради същата причина Linux вече може да играе много игри, предназначени за Windows, с подобна производителност и минимални проблеми. Обяснихме как работи този „ефект на просмукване“ в нашата статия за какво е Proton GE и как подобрява съвместимостта на игрите на SteamOS и Linux.

Но има една уловка: не всички игри работят. Много игри бъгват и още повече изобщо не работят. Все пак, както видяхме в миналото, в зависимост от приложенията и игрите, които използвате, може да е възможно безпроблемно преминаване към Linux от Windows.

Linux сега по-добър ли е за игри от Windows? Ето защо не е

И така, преминаването към Linux сега ли е пътят напред за игрите? Не точно. Все още има няколко проблема, които няма да срещнете, когато използвате машина с Windows за игра на Steam игри.

1. Ограничителната DRM не харесва Linux

DRM и неговият брат, анти-чийт, са неудобство за геймърите и е доказано, че оказват влияние върху производителността. Това е основната причина много хора да не харесват най-популярното решение против подправяне, както обяснихме в нашата статия какво е Denuvo и защо всички го мразят.

Все пак такива решения се считат за необходими и за игри с троен A. Една "неразбиваема" защита може да предостави на производителя на игри безопасен начален прозорец на гарантирани продажби.

Решенията против измама, внедрени подобно на DRM, могат да осигурят честно игрово изживяване за всички, като предотвратяват измама. Но те също могат да бъдат неудобство.

Valve или си сътрудничи с DRM/анти-чийт компании и създатели на игри, за да рендира най-популярните заглавия, съвместими със Steam Deck (и, като разширение, Linux), или внедри свои собствени заобикалящи решения, за да гарантира съвместимост с най-известната „защита на играта“ решения.

Все пак може да се натъкнете на случайно заглавие, което отказва да работи на Linux, не защото самото заглавие, а защото неговият DRM или анти-чийт е несъвместим с операционната система на Tux.

2. Проблеми със стартирането на трети страни на Linux

Ако наскоро сте закупили тройна игра от Steam, тя вероятно е дошла с допълнителен стартер. Повечето такива програми за стартиране работят на Linux, но един или два не. Поне не винаги (здравей, Rockstar Games Launcher). И Linux не е в списъка с приоритети на техните създатели.

Но да приемем, че сте закупили заглавие от Steam Store или друг дигитален магазин, чийто стартер работи на Linux, благодарение на неговите създатели или усилията на общността. Проверихте ли предварително дали играта идва със собствен персонализиран стартер? Това също може да е проблем.

Специфичният за играта стартер може да се „развали“, тъй като е объркан от неочакваната среда, в която се оказа, че работи (известен още като: Linux-преструвайки се-да-бе-Windows). Може да е налично решение (като директно стартиране на изпълнимия файл на играта или използване на някои персонализирани допълнителни флагове). Но не е даденост.

3. Поддръжката на Linux емулатор малко липсва

Не е ли чудесно, че вашият компютър с Windows ви позволява да се наслаждавате на заглавия, направени за други платформи чрез магията на емулацията? Изживяването може да бъде още по-добро на Linux, благодарение на по-ниските разходи за операционната система, по-добрите хардуерни драйвери и по-компетентното управление на паметта.

Освен ако не искате да играете и игри на Xbox 360.

Ксения, най-добрият (и единственият напълно работещ) емулатор за Xbox 360, който видяхме в нашето ръководство за как да играете игри на Xbox 360 на компютър с Xenia на Windows, както се казва в заглавието на нашето ръководство, е наличен само в Windows.

Искахте ли също да експериментирате с новото fpPS4, което изглежда обещаващо при емулирането на PlayStation 4 на компютърен хардуер? Да, този също е наличен само в Windows - поне засега.

В днешно време можем да играем на класиките, които се възползваха от Voodoo „графичните ускорители“ на 3dfx чрез персонализирани „обвивки“. Тези приложения добавят слой на съвместимост към нашите съвременни графични процесори, които могат да изпълняват класически DOS или Windows 9x 3D-ускорени заглавия в модерни операционни системи. Ако тези "модерни операционни системи" се наричат ​​"Windows".

Спомняте ли си да играете F.E.A.R. или друго старо любимо заглавие, използвайки впечатляващото многоканално позиционно 3D аудио на Creative EAX? Windows Vista на Microsoft "счупи" съвместимостта с EAX, но Creative издаде корекция под формата на своя Творческо приложение ALchemy. Само за Windows, разбира се.

Можете да опитате "отворена" алтернатива, OpenAL Софт, но може да не работи толкова добре. Въпреки това, той е по-добър с това, че за разлика от решението на Creative, той е "хардуерен агностик" и можете да го използвате с всяка модерна аудио система.

Най-малкото можете да подобрите визуализациите на игрите си като в Windows с Преоцветете. Трябва само да използвате vkБазалт, ръчно импортирайте шейдърите на Reshade, уверете се, че тези, които искате да използвате, работят, и ги персонализирайте без GUI. Ако всичко това звучи като скучна работа, а не като „забавление“, може би Linux игрите не са най-добрият вариант за вас.

5. Windows ви дава най-новото и най-доброто, Ден първи

Опитните геймъри знаят, че е най-добре да избягват предварителната поръчка на игри. Трейлърите на ново заглавие може да го направят да изглежда като най-доброто нещо след нарязания хляб. И въпреки това може да се окаже „един от онези лоши портове за компютър“, да му липсва половината от обещаните функции или да „работи“ като охлюв на вашия хардуер.

Освен това, ако сте на Linux, няма смисъл да го поръчвате предварително, за да го играете от първия ден: the достойната за похвала общност може да трябва да работи върху него до седемдесет и шести ден, за да гарантира, че действително работи както би трябвало.

По същия начин не очаквайте най-новите функции, свързани с игрите на най-новия хардуер, да работят на Linux от първия ден. Поне не без случайни проблеми тук и там. RTX ефекти? Повишаване на мащаба? Физика? Tux Racer няма нужда от целия този пух.

Все още не разчитайте на Linux

Колкото и зле да правим игрите на Linux звучни, ние разглеждаме само проблемите, с които ще трябва да се сблъскате, когато играете на операционната система. Благодарение на Steam Deck, WINE и Proton, много игри за Windows вече могат да се играят на Linux - особено най-популярните.

Повечето емулатори предлагат собствени версии на Linux и за всяка помощна програма на трета страна, която можете да използвате в Windows (като Cheat Engine), обикновено можете да намерите дори по-добри алтернативи.

Linux е страхотен, защото ви позволява да работите с него, да го персонализирате и да го направите свой собствен. Но може и да не е за вас поради същите причини: понякога трябва да се занимавате с него и да харчите часове проучване как да променяте настройките на играта или да се забърквате с нейните файлове, за да работи както искате (ако на всичко).

Игри на Linux: Не е най-добрият, но не е далеч

Със Steam Deck, работещ с Linux OS, ще ви бъде простено да се чудите дали игрите на Linux са по-добри в Windows сега. Ако предпочитате „изживяването на конзолата“ пред „сложността“ на игрите на компютри с Windows, опитът да играете на Linux ще изглежда като много по-сложно начинание.

Ако все пак обичате да се гмурнете в конфигурационните файлове на любимата си игра, за да ги оптимизирате за вашия хардуер и да преследвате неофициални инструменти в забравени форуми, които могат да направят любимото ви ретро заглавие да изглежда по най-добрия начин, потопете се, защото може да ви хареса то.